Every software team should strive for excellence in building security into their software and infrastructure. This is more crucial than ever, given increasing cyber security risks and growing enterprise liability awareness. The days when perimeter security alone could ensure resilient, secure systems are long gone. Threat modelling is a powerful practice that instills security thinking into software engineering teams, preventing potential attacks. It’s a risk-based approach to designing secure systems by identifying threats continually and developing mitigations intentionally. I will be introducing steps to do threat modelling in software teams with an established STRIDE framework.
In this talk Melissa is going to walk through my experience of leading an Automation Test strategy across an organisation. We’ll talk through how to get that balance right between test automation and hands on testing. Then we’ll delve deeper into the practicalities and common challenges with implementing that strategy. Lastly, we will go onto exploring tips to get started in Test automation with a handful of useful resources to explore.
What to consider in creating an Automation Test Strategy
Common challenges and solutions in implementing an Automation Test Strategy
Tips to get started in Test Automation

The Test Tribe is the World’s Largest Software Testing Community turned EdTech Startup. Started in 2018 with a mission to give Testing Craft the glory it deserves while we co-create Smarter, prouder, and confident Testers.
We take pride in solving upskilling and growth for global Testing professionals through our unique offerings like Expert Courses, Membership, Cohorts, Offline Mixers, online Community spaces, and a lot of global Events.
Our offerings enable Software Testers globally to collaborate, learn, and grow together. With around 270+ Software Testing Events like Conferences, Hackathons, Meetups, Webinars, etc., and with other Community initiatives, we have reached a global footprint of over 120K+ Testers from 130+ Countries. We intend to provide life-altering growth to every single Testing professional on the planet through community and technology.
